Output 6028e9775c676321a32e66568777605f997062610e8befc1ad7c7cbfae476d56:7

value
3058860096
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5261bca2187f8c9d0f2909ddc2b2db57fc0b801d OP_EQUALVERIFY OP_CHECKSIG
address
18WbVc7UNnStB15APH1FLJX9zm13n1C7RC
transaction
6028e9775c676321a32e66568777605f997062610e8befc1ad7c7cbfae476d56
spent
true